Smart Arranging Systems



Implementing clever sorting systems revolutionizes rubbish collection by improving the process and enhancing performance. These systems use innovative innovation to automatically arrange recyclables from general waste, reducing contamination degrees and boosting the amount of product that can be reused. By including sensors and artificial intelligence, smart sorting systems can recognize different sorts of materials, such as plastics, glass, and paper, with amazing accuracy.

With the ability to separate products at the resource, clever sorting systems make recycling easier for individuals and companies alike. By enhancing the top quality of recyclables collected, these systems add to an extra lasting waste administration process.

Additionally, the data collected from these systems can help municipalities track recycling rates, recognize trends, and maximize collection courses.

Waste-to-Energy Technologies



With waste generation rising, finding sustainable remedies is coming to be significantly important. Waste-to-Energy (WtE) innovations use a promising technique to managing our waste while generating power. These innovations involve converting non-recyclable waste materials right into usable forms of energy like electrical power, heat, or fuel.



By drawing away waste from garbage dumps and blazing it in regulated setups, WtE not only lowers the volume of waste however also generates useful energy resources.

One usual method of WtE is mass-burn incineration, where waste is burned at heats to generate steam that drives wind turbines creating electricity. Another technique is gasification, which transforms waste right into artificial gas that can be used for power generation or as a chemical feedstock.

Additionally, anaerobic food digestion breaks down organic waste to produce biogas for energy.

Implementing WtE technologies can help reduce greenhouse gas emissions, reduce dependence on nonrenewable fuel sources, and decrease the ecological effect of waste disposal.
